About Ethics and Professional Responsibility Law in Rouen, France
Ethics and Professional Responsibility law in Rouen, France, involves the legal standards that govern professional conduct across various occupations, emphasizing the importance of maintaining integrity, accountability, and trustworthiness in professional practices. Rouen, as a historic and cultural city, adheres to the national regulations that dictate ethical practices in professions such as law, healthcare, and business. These laws are designed to uphold the reputation of the professions by ensuring practitioners adhere to established ethical codes and disciplinary actions are taken when violations occur.

Local Laws Overview
Rouen, like other cities in France, follows a national framework for Ethics and Professional Responsibility while being attentive to local customs and societal norms:
- France’s legal system has strict codes of conduct for professions, with particular emphasis on fields like law and medicine.
- Professional bodies in Rouen often have their own codes of ethics, which align with national regulations.
- The French legal system incorporates formal sanctions for breaches, which can include fines, suspension, or loss of professional licenses.
- The local judiciary in Rouen is responsible for adjudicating cases relating to ethical violations, with an emphasis on rehabilitation and prevention.
- Continuous education and updates to the ethical standards are mandatory for many professions, ensuring practitioners remain informed about current legal obligations.
Frequently Asked Questions
1. What constitutes a breach of professional ethics in Rouen?
A breach of professional ethics could be any action that violates the professional conduct guidelines established by a relevant professional body or law, such as dishonesty, conflict of interest, or confidentiality violations.
2. How are ethical complaints filed?
Ethical complaints are typically filed with the relevant professional body or regulatory authority, which will then investigate the complaint according to their procedures and local laws.
3. What are the potential consequences of a breach of ethics?
Consequences range from formal warnings to more severe measures such as fines, suspension, and revocation of professional practicing rights.
4. Can ethical standards vary between different professions?
Yes, ethical standards can vary significantly depending on the profession, as each sector has specific requirements and expectations that are codified in unique ethical guidelines.
5. Is it obligatory for professionals in Rouen to report unethical behavior?
In many cases, yes. Professionals may have a duty to report unethical behavior to the appropriate regulatory authority or face potential penalties themselves.
6. Are there resources for professionals to learn about their ethical obligations?
Professional associations and regulatory bodies often provide educational resources, workshops, and seminars to help their members understand and comply with ethical obligations.
7. Can a professional dispute an ethical violation claim?
Yes, professionals can dispute claims of ethical violation, often through formal hearings or by presenting their case before a committee or legal body.
8. Who can assist with an ethical violation case?
Legal experts specializing in professional responsibility can provide valuable guidance and representation in ethical violation cases.
9. How does one maintain compliance with ethical standards?
Professionals should stay informed about updates in their field and engage in continuous professional development to ensure adherence to standards.
10. What role do ethics play in gaining public trust in Rouen?
Adherence to ethical standards is crucial for maintaining public trust and confidence in professionals and institutions.
Additional Resources
Seeking guidance from the following resources can provide additional insights and support for those in need of legal advice regarding Ethics and Professional Responsibility:
- Local Bar Association of Rouen for legal professionals.
- The Ordre National des Médecins for healthcare professionals.
- La Chambre de Commerce et d'Industrie de Rouen for business-related ethics.
